They are in parks, running around in train stations and spreading through the Munich city area – they are not welcome. We’re talking about rats. They seem to feel immediately at home in the city. Last November, t-online reported about a rat in a kebab shop at the Ostbahnhof in Munich, which had made itself comfortable on the worktop.
Until now, poison bait has been used to control rodents, but this method has not had much success. As Merkur reports, the ÖDP and Munich List faction has now submitted an application to the city council. This includes two points on rat control. The aim is to combat rats ‘more humanely’. The emphasis should be on prevention rather than poisoning. Liquid bait with contraceptive technology should be placed on the hot spots. The points of interest in question include the Nussbaum Park, the Viktualienmarkt and the area around the major train stations.
These liquid baits are intended to reduce the rat population. The group suggests that the pilot project should run for about one to two years. If there are positive results, this contraceptive technology should be used across the board, the filing said. The milky liquid baits are said to contain active ingredients that render both male and female rats infertile. Moreover, they are not harmful to the environment and harmless to other animal species. “The rats do not have to suffer, but their population is still gradually declining,” the application says.
Simply poisoning animals with poisonous bait is neither promising nor compatible with animal welfare. In Munich, non-access-protected bait stations are currently being used again and again. An active ingredient that is often used is “Difenacoum”. However, it is very dangerous, as the factions explain. Not only for rats, but also for birds of prey and other animals that eat the bait.
